#a710e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a710e6 is composed of 65.5% red, 6.3%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.4% cyan, 93%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 282.3 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 48.2%. #a710e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#4f00cd.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#a710e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010a is the darkest color, while #fcf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a710e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c787e is the less saturated color, while #ab07ef is the most saturated one.
